Immune-related hypophysitis in a 56-year-old woman with metastatic melanoma receiving ipilimumab and nivolumab and with headaches at presentation. Coronal MR image after 8 weeks of ipilimumab and nivolumab therapy shows an enlarged pituitary gland (*) and infundibular thickening (arrow), representing immune-related hypophysitis. The symptom and findings resolved after corticosteroid therapy.
